We are EssilorLuxottica, a global leader in the design, manufacture and distribution of ophthalmic lenses, frames and sunglasses. The Company brings together the complementary expertise of two industry pioneers, one in advanced lens technologies and the other in the craftsmanship of iconic eyewear, to create a vertically integrated business that is uniquely positioned to address the world’s evolving vision needs and the global demand of a growing eyewear industry.

With over 180,000 dedicated employees in 150 countries driving our iconic brands, our people are creative, entrepreneurial and celebrated for their unique perspectives and individuality. Committed to vision, we enable people to “see more and be more” thanks to our innovative designs and lens technologies, exceptional quality and cutting-edge processing methods. Every day we impact the lives of millions by changing the way people see the world.

Our portfolio of more than 150 renowned brands span various categories, from frames, lenses and instruments to brick and mortar and digital distribution as well as mid-range to premium segments. GENERAL FUNCTION

As a participant in the EssilorLuxottica Internship Program, you will work towards a life-enhancing mission that unites us all. We believe vision is a basic human right, and by bringing together world-leading expertise in lens and eyewear technology, we are promising a brighter future for the hundreds of millions of people we serve globally. Therefore, whatever role you are in, you can make a meaningful difference to people’s lives.

The EssilorLuxottica Full-Time internship spans 10 weeks in the summer (with opportunities to extend Part-Time during the academic year) and allows you to become fully immersed into EssilorLuxottica and its brands. You will perform meaningful work that delivers real impact, take part in learning and career development sessions, and experience one-on-one mentorship and interactive networking events.

Major Duties And Responsibilities

  • Support the team responsible for implementing the organization’s communications, marketing, and/or, public relations strategy.
  • Build relationships and maintain communication between partners and various stakeholders.
  • Assist in managing the content calendar, project management, event production, social media management, and asset management.
  • Generate new ideas and drive best practices to engage better with internal and external audiences.
  • Create engaging content for social media platforms, press releases, and newsletters.
  • Gather information and verify facts and statistics to be used in various communications.
  • Read, evaluate, and edit content for adherence to company styles, standards, and formats.
  • Conduct research to identify consumer trends and client needs.
  • Manage and develop campaigns.
  • Prepare proposals and deliver presentations.
  • Track, analyze, and report outreach efforts to draw insights and facilitate sound decision making and future strategies.


Basic Qualifications

  • Seeking a degree in Business, Communications, English, Journalism, Marketing, Public Relations, or a related field of study.
  • Available for the full 10-week program, 40 hours per week.
  • Legal authorization to work in the U.S. required on the first day of employment.
  • Ability to craft concise, creative, and compelling messaging.
  • Experience with engagement and building community on digital platforms.
  • Proficiency with presentation software, graphic design, and photoshop.
  • Strong interpersonal skills, a collaborative mindset, maturity and good judgment.
  • Excellent communication skills, both oral and written.
  • Must be organized, detail-oriented, able to multi-task, and evaluate priorities in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Demonstrated ability to maintain high standards of confidentiality.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and Microsoft Teams.


Preferred Qualifications

  • Previous internship or work experience in similar functions/business units.
  • Leadership roles on campus and/or community involvement.
  • Study abroad or international exposure.
